The Community School of Music and Arts (CSMA) has been providing quality arts education on the mid-peninsula since 1968. As a non-profit organization, we now deliver professional in-school and after-school arts programming to 7,000+ children at over 30 schools in Santa Clara and San Mateo counties in addition to many programs at our Mountain View arts education center.

We believe that every child should receive the benefits that music and art education provide. While in the past this important instruction may have been delivered by school staff or specialists, unfortunately, this simply may not be possible today.

CSMA can provide a curriculum-based, cost-effective alternative for schools unable to have music and art teachers on staff. This is not a new idea. In fact, since 1981, we have taught all of the music and art classes in Mountain View’s public elementary schools.
